Big, creamy butter beans give a tuna and celery salad terrific heartiness. The salad would also be delicious spooned over slices of warm grilled country bread.
I sometimes serve this over a bed of lettuce as a large, main-course salad. It’s very filling, and butter beans are heart healthy!

Ingredients
2 tablespoon(s) fresh lemon juice
2 teaspoon(s) Dijon mustard
1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
1/4 cup(s) snipped chives (I use scallions for a little stronger flavor)
Kosher salt and freshly ground pepper
1/2 ounce each) Italian tuna in olive oil, drained
3 celery stalks with leaves, thinly sliced on the bias
15 ounces each) butter beans, drained and rinsed
1 1/2 tablespoon(s) drained capers
Instructions
1.In a small bowl, whisk the lemon juice with the mustard, then slowly whisk in the olive oil. Stir in the chives and season the lemon-mustard vinaigrette with salt and pepper.
2.In a large bowl, gently toss the drained tuna with the sliced celery, butter beans, and capers. Add the lemon-mustard vinaigrette and toss to coat the salad. Season the salad with salt and pepper and serve at once.
